How the chain works

  1. 1Register a plant. Give it a name, a species, and where it came from. It gets a permanent code like GC-7K2P.
  2. 2Propagate it. Take a cutting or division and register the offspring from the parent. The two are now linked.
  3. 3Trace the provenance. Every plant shows its full ancestry and descendants, plus a fingerprint that changes if any ancestor does.
